Discussions about anything related to marine saltwater and reef tanks. Here we'll discuss everything from basic Fish Only tank care to advanced reef system care. We will also discuss equipment and DIY type projects.

    This week with a "back to the basics" type show for you all. In this show i cover two topic. The first topic is on various types of water testing and details on water parameters, and the second is a quick topic on Aptasia control methods, here are some details: Water testing and Parameters: - Refratometers and Hydrometers - Specific Gravity and Salinity - Nitrate Nitrite and Ammonia - PH - Calcium, Alkalinity, Magnesium Aptasia Control: Natural: - Peppermint Shrimp - Copperband Butterfly fish - Berghia Nudibranch Non Natural: - Kalk Paste - joes juice/lemon juice - vinegar - boiling water
